Unless otherwise stated, sterilize media by autoclaving at 121°C for 15 min.
1342 MODIFIED RFENNIG MEDIUM WITH FERRIHYDRITE
NaCl | 2.0 | g |
KH2PO4 | 0.2 | g |
NH4Cl | 0.25 | g |
MgCl2·6H2O | 0.5 | g |
KCl | 0.4 | g |
CaCl2·2H2O | 0.4 | g |
Distilled water | 1.0 | L |
Mix components thoroughly. Distribute the medium into culture vessels containing ferrihydrite slurry (see below, ca. 50 mM ferrihydrite) under a gas stream of CO2, seal with butyl rubber stoppers and autoclave. After cooling, aseptically and anaerobically add per liter the following solutions (autoclaved or *filter-sterilized):
8% NaHCO3 solution* | 50.0 | ml |
1.0 M Sodium formate solution | 10.0 | ml |
Trace vitamins* (see Medium No. 197) | 10.0 | ml |
Trace element solution* (see Medium No. 899) | 1.0 | ml |
Iron(III) citrate solution* (see Medium No. 1014) | 50.0 | ml |
Check pH to be 6.8-7.0.
Ferrihydrite slurry:
Slowly titrate 400 ml of 20 mM FeCl3·6H2O solution with 10% (w/v) NaOH to pH 7.0-7.5 with agitation on a magnetic stirrer. Wash the precipitate with distilled water three times. Remove the ferrihydrite suspension into a container, cover with water and store at room temperature overnight. Remove supernatant after centrifugation at 2000 rpm for 5 min. Distribute ferrihydrite slurry to culture vessels before pouring the medium described above (final frrihydrite concentration is approximately 50 mM in medium).
